原文:CMake实践(3)

一,本期目标 sun localhost t cat README t :静态库 .a 与动态库 .so 构建 任务: ,建立一个静态库和动态库,提供HelloFunc函数供其他程序编程使用 HelloFunc向终端输出Hello World字符串 ,安装头文件与共享库使用方法到 lt path to gt t build,执行:cmake DCMAKE INSTALL PREFIX home T ...

2014-06-10 15:21 0 3054 推荐指数:

查看详情

CMake实践》笔记二:INSTALL/CMAKE_INSTALL_PREFIX

CMake实践》笔记一:PROJECT/MESSAGE/ADD_EXECUTABLE 《CMake实践》笔记二:INSTALL/CMAKE_INSTALL_PREFIX 《CMake实践》笔记三:构建静态库与动态库 及 如何使用外部共享库和头文件 四、更好一点的Hello World ...

Tue Jul 19 00:25:00 CST 2016 3 23904
Cmake实践Cmake Practice)第二部分

参考资料地址:https://github.com/Akagi201/learning-cmake/blob/master/docs/cmake-practice.pdf 一、静态库与动态库构建 本小节目标如下: 建立一个静态库和动态库,提供HelloFunc函数供其他程序编程使用 ...

Thu Jan 10 00:43:00 CST 2019 0 826
CMake---优雅地构建软件项目实践(1)

本文属于原创,转载注明出处,欢迎关注微信小程序小白AI博客 微信公众号小白AI或者网站 https://xiaobaiai.net 或者我的CSDN http://blog.csdn.net/free ...

Fri Mar 20 03:22:00 CST 2020 0 872
CMake使用总结(转的)+自己的实践心得

来自https://www.mawenbao.com/note/cmake.html 总结CMake的常用命令,并介绍有用的CMake资源。 CMake意为cross-platform make,可用于管理c/c++工程。CMake解析配置文件CMakeLists.txt生成Makefile ...

Wed Oct 25 18:34:00 CST 2017 0 3049
Cmake实践Cmake Practice)第一部分

参考资料地址:https://github.com/Akagi201/learning-cmake/blob/master/docs/cmake-practice.pdf 一、初识cmake 1. Cmake特点 开放源代码 跨平台 能够管理大型项目 简化编译构建和编译过程 ...

Wed Jan 09 22:31:00 CST 2019 3 4443
CMake实践》笔记一:PROJECT/MESSAGE/ADD_EXECUTABLE

CMake实践》笔记一:PROJECT/MESSAGE/ADD_EXECUTABLE 《CMake实践》笔记二:INSTALL/CMAKE_INSTALL_PREFIX 《CMake实践》笔记三:构建静态库与动态库 及 如何使用外部共享库和头文件 前言: 开发了5,6年的时间 ...

Tue Jul 19 00:24:00 CST 2016 1 12028
Ubuntu下cmake教程实践从入门到会用

如果你下载别人的开源代码,你会发现很多人的项目中有个CMakeLists.txt。其实这是因为他们用cmake这个软件来编译整个项目。 为何要用cmake? 如果不用cmake的话那么我们一般会用visual studio这种软件来编译运行整个项目。但是这里有个问题 ...

Thu Jun 13 17:58:00 CST 2019 0 1207
cmake

https://cmake.org/cmake/help/v3.18/manual/cmake.1.html 概要 介绍 cmake可执行文件是一个命令行跨平台构建系统生成器的接口。上面概要介绍的各种各样的命令将会在下面详细介绍。 使用cmake编译一个软件工程,需要构建一个编译系统 ...

Fri Sep 25 22:52:00 CST 2020 0 770
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M